Solution for 6(x-3)=4x+2 equation:



6(x-3)=4x+2
We move all terms to the left:
6(x-3)-(4x+2)=0
We multiply parentheses
6x-(4x+2)-18=0
We get rid of parentheses
6x-4x-2-18=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x-20=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
2x=20
x=20/2
x=10
